What is Involved in Removing a Chimney Structural?

Removing a chimney structural involves a series of steps that must be carefully planned and executed. The first step is to assess the chimney’s condition and determine whether it is safe to remove. This involves inspecting the chimney for any signs of damage or deterioration, such as cracks, decay, or water damage. Next, the chimney must be carefully dismantled, taking care to preserve the surrounding structure and prevent any damage to the roof or walls. Finally, the chimney’s foundation must be removed, and the area must be reinforced to ensure load support and prevent any potential collapse.

The process of removing a chimney structural requires a deep understanding of load support and roof framing. The chimney’s weight is typically supported by the roof and walls, and removing it can create a void that must be filled to maintain structural integrity. This is where roof framing comes into play, as the roof’s structure must be reinforced to compensate for the loss of the chimney. Masonry demo is also a critical component of the process, as the chimney’s foundation and surrounding structure must be carefully demolished to prevent any damage to the surrounding area.

How Does Load Support Work in Removing a Chimney Structural?

Load support is a critical aspect of removing a chimney structural. The chimney’s weight is typically supported by the roof and walls, and removing it can create a void that must be filled to maintain structural integrity. To achieve this, a temporary support system must be installed to hold the roof and walls in place while the chimney is being removed. This can include installing temporary beams or columns to support the roof and walls, as well as reinforcing the foundation to prevent any potential collapse.

In addition to temporary support systems, load support also involves reinforcing the roof and walls to compensate for the loss of the chimney. This can include installing new beams or columns to support the roof and walls, as well as reinforcing the foundation to prevent any potential collapse. By carefully planning and executing load support, it is possible to remove a chimney structural while maintaining the integrity of the surrounding structure.

What Are the Advantages and Disadvantages of Traditional Stick-Framing?

Traditional stick-framing has several advantages and disadvantages. One of the main advantages is its flexibility, as it can be used to create complex roof shapes and designs. Additionally, stick-framing provides a high degree of control over the construction process, as each beam and joist can be carefully placed and secured. However, stick-framing can be more time-consuming and labor-intensive than other types of framing, which can increase the cost and duration of the project.

In addition to traditional stick-framing, truss-framing is another common type of roof framing used in removing a chimney structural. Truss-framing involves using pre-fabricated trusses to support the roof, rather than individual beams and joists. Trusses provide a high degree of strength and stability, and can be used to create large, open spaces. However, they can be more expensive than traditional stick-framing, and may require specialized equipment and labor to install.

What is the Cost of Removing a Chimney Structural?

The cost of removing a chimney structural can vary widely, depending on the size and complexity of the project. On average, the cost of removing a chimney structural can range from $5,000 to $20,000 or more, depending on the location, design, and construction of the chimney and surrounding structure.

How Long Does it Take to Remove a Chimney Structural?

The duration of the project will depend on the size and complexity of the chimney, as well as the design and construction of the roof and walls. On average, the process of removing a chimney structural can take several weeks to several months, depending on the scope of the project.

Do I Need to Hire a Licensed Structural Engineer to Remove a Chimney Structural?

Yes, it is highly recommended that you hire a licensed structural engineer to remove a chimney structural. A licensed structural engineer has the expertise and experience to assess the condition of the chimney and surrounding structure, and to design and execute a safe and effective removal plan.

What Are the Risks of Removing a Chimney Structural Without a Licensed Structural Engineer?

Removing a chimney structural without a licensed structural engineer can be risky and potentially dangerous. Without proper planning and execution, the removal of a chimney structural can result in damage to the surrounding structure, injury to people, and even collapse of the roof or walls.
